[ARCHIVED] Applicants Sought for Bismarck Human Relations Committee

Mayor Mike Seminary is seeking Bismarck residents who are interested in serving on the Bismarck Human Relations Committee. The volunteer committee has two open positions. One, one-year unexpired term that ends January 2016; and one, three-year unexpired term that ends January 2018. Anyone residing in the City of Bismarck is eligible for appointment. Please designate which open position you are applying for on the application form. The deadline for applications is August 14, 2015. The new committee members will be announced at an upcoming City Commission meeting.

The mission of the Mayor’s Human Relations Committee is to protect and promote the personal dignity of all Bismarck citizens and to eliminate any discriminatory barriers that prevent them from reaching their full human potential.

The Human Relations Committee meets the third Monday of every month at the City/County Building. The committee has adopted a policy that Human Relations Committee members must attend eight out of twelve monthly meetings.

Interested Bismarck residents should send Mayor Seminary a letter and or application describing their qualifications, background, and why they would be interested in serving on the committee.
